As soon as they had entered the trauma centre, Aaron was wheeled inside the ICU.

When the hospital learnt about who Destiny was, high positioned doctors came to take Aaron's case, though nothing could ease the girl's heart.

Sasha remained by her side, rubbing her arm. Trying to be as useful as possible.

"Destiny, you should call your parents." She softly said.

Destiny was staring blankly ahead, she didn't even shed any tear, she felt hollow deep inside. There was still blood on her hands from wiping Aaron's mouth.

"Destiny." Sasha called again when she didn't reply.

She turned to her finally but stared at her face with a void look.

"Hm?"

"You must inform your parents. Should I call them for you?"

Destiny didn't know if she could handle anyone else's aching heart at this moment. She needed to be left alone. It was all too much.

"Not now." She replied in monotone.

Sasha stayed quiet afterwards.

After what felt like an eternity passed in remote silence, a doctor walked out of the ICU, removing his gloves and mask.

Destiny sprang on her feet and ran to him, not saying anything but her eyes asked everything.

"His vitals are stable." He began, Destiny almost collapsed from relief but held her ground. She could sense a 'but' in his tone.

"What happened?" She asked coldly. Sasha and Kayde by her side.

The doctor, whose name tag read Joseph, sighed and looked scared for a moment before replying.

"He was poisoned. A slow kind. He had that poison in him for a whole night. Most of the substance had already blended inside but we did our best to flush out as much as possible.

The rest depends on Aaron himself. How his body fights and recovers. We can't tell if he'll be able to get out of it or not. But we did and will continue to do our best to get him out of it."

Destiny's lips trembled as she blinked rapidly, digesting his words. Her crazy eyes roamed around for a split second then turned back at Joseph.

"When will he wake up?"

Doctor Joseph sighed again and shared a glance with Sasha and Kayde, all of them realizing really well that the billionaire wasn't in her right mind right now.

The only solution was to state the truth out, clear. No matter how hurtful it might be.

"Mrs. Archer, we don't know if your husband's body is strong enough to fight the poison and wake up, ever again. We can only pray and hope for the best."

He could literally see Destiny's world shattering right through her eyes and sympathetically patted her hand before leaving her standing there like a frozen statue.

*One month later*

"Here's the papers you asked for."

"Thanks, Sasha." Destiny smiled at her, taking the file to go through the papers for the new contract.

"I've got them checked by Fin and Jake, everything's okay for you to accept it."

Nodding to her words, Destiny got her pen off the table and quickly signed the designated spots. Finalizing a new contract that'd make sure her companies thrive.

She felt happy after a long time.

She handed the papers back to Sasha who took her leave from her office. Just as Destiny was putting the pen back down on the holder, her eyes fell on the photo on her desk.

A silver framed photo of her and her beloved husband's. It was taken on their first date night.

Destiny had her arms wrapped around Aaron's shoulders from behind as she admired his side profile, while Aaron held her arms from the front and was laughing at something she'd said.

Even amidst the darkness of the night, their smiles illuminated the photo, and Destiny felt a tug at her heart.

Softly smiling, she let her finger trace over the beautiful capture.

"I'll be home soon, baby."

Destiny wrapped up her work by evening, and left her office building around 5 pm.

She was about to get in the car when Sasha came running to her, panting a little indicating she ran fast to catch up to her.

"What is it?" Destiny asked, feeling rather anxious by her secretary's expression.

Gasping for breath, Sasha put a hand over her knee to catch air. "W-we got him."

And just like that, Destiny's mood lifted, eyes darkening and hand gripping the car door tighter.

A smirk formed on her face as she clenched her other hand, heart wrenching painfully inside her chest.

"Start the preparation. I'll meet you on the spot on time."

Sasha nodded, a wide smile painted on her face as she raised a thumb at her boss.

Destiny got in the car and the whole way to her apartment, she couldn't keep her heart from leaping and jumping as several ideas played in her mind.

"I'm so sorry, baby. I hurried home but still got late." She said as soon as she got home and quickly put away her coat and bag. "But I've got good news." She excitedly added.

Removing her shoes, blouse, skirt, Destiny got in a hoodie and sweatpants, climbing on the bed with a grin.

"I got him, baby. I got that bastard and now he's gonna pay for what he did to you. It wasn't easy escaping him and his man from jail, but we did it. Now, he's gonna see actual hell.

I promised you, didn't I? It's gonna be my anniversary gift for you. Just you wait and see. But I need you to be h-here for it." She swallowed as her voice tended to crack.

As delicately as one could, Destiny took his hand in hers, bringing it up to place a kiss on the back of it.

"I-I need you here w-with me. You- you can't leave me alone on o- our first anniversary, Aaron."

One by one tear drops cascaded down her face but she vigorously wiped them away. She refused to fall weak, not in front of Aaron.

She needed to stay strong for the both of them. But how long? She was breaking inside.

"Come back to me, baby. Please. I can't carry on without you much longer. I need you h-here. Please, Aaron."

She slowly laid herself down beside the boy who'd been lying on their bed, motionless, for the past month, without showing any sign of movement.

Destiny rested her head against his and put an arm over his torso, closing her eyes she focused on the heart monitor continuously and steadily beating, giving her hopes of a future when they'd be together again.
